0

私のワンプは完全に正常に動作します。localhost、phpmyadmin、および他のすべての php、html などのファイルには、localhost url からアクセスできます。しかし、他のphpファイルを参照しているphpファイルにアクセスしようとするとrequire_once("config.php"); 、次のエラーが発生します。

このサーバーの /myfolder/myfile.php/" . $requests_url . " にアクセスする権限がありません。

例えば

<?php
    /* Works fine*/
    echo "Test";
 ?>


<?php
   /* Give forbidden error*/
   require_once("config.php");
   echo "Test";
?>

http.confiq apachi設定ファイルで行う必要があるすべての権限と設定を既に許可しています。今はこんな感じで、

<Directory "c:/wamp/www/">

    Options Indexes FollowSymLinks Includes  ExecCGI 
    AllowOverride all
    Order allow,deny
    Allow from all

</Directory>
4

1 に答える 1

0

おそらく、パーミッションの設定が間違っているでしょう:) apache configはそれとは何の関係もないと思います。スーパーユーザーとして wamp を起動するオプションが必要かもしれません (もちろん、そのファイルのアクセス許可を 10 回確認して再確認した場合は、実行可能ファイルを右クリックする必要があると思います)

于 2012-11-12T07:16:21.550 に答える